Thai PM in Sri Lanka...
July 12, 2018
Prime Minister of Thailand General Prayut Chan-o-cha and his spouse Associate Professor Naraporn Chan-o-cha, arrived in Sri Lanka on an Official Visit on Thursday from 12 - 13 July 2018. The Prime Minister of Thailand was accompanied by Thailand’s Minister of Foreign Affairs, Mr. Don Pramudwinai, Minister Attached to the Prime Minister’s Office, Mr. Kobsak Pootrakool, Deputy Minister of Commerce, Ms. Chutima Bunyapraphasara and senior officials from relevant Ministries.
The purpose of the visit is to further strengthen the bilateral relations between Thailand and Sri Lanka to the level of Strategic Economic Partnership and to enhance the relations between the two countries in key areas such as trade and investment, technical cooperation, religious and cultural ties and tourism as well as to exchange views on regional issues, particularly maritime connectivity.
During the visit, the Prime Minister of Thailand is scheduled to hold a bilateral discussion and co-chair the Plenary Meeting with President of Sri Lanka, Maithripala Sirisena at the Presidential Secretariat. Both leaders will witness the signing of important documents.
